Clinical Quality

Unity utilizes NCQA's HEDIS®* as a measurement tool to provide a reliable assessment of our quality efforts. HEDIS® is the measurement tool used by the nation's health plans to evaluate their performance in terms of clinical quality and customer service.

Unity's 2010 (Measurement Year 2009) Commercial HMO/POS HEDIS®* Results

Measure  Unity Score  National Average
Childhood Immunization Status  83.94%  65.21%
Appropriate Treatment for Children with URI  91.16%  83.40%
Appropriate Testing for Children with  Pharyngitis  86.77%  76.54%
Colorectal Cancer Screening  68.37%  54.83%
Breast Cancer Screening  76.95%  69.84%
Cervical Cancer Screening  84.78%  76.13%
Diabetes Care-A1C Testing  90.15%  86.93%
Diabetes Care-A1C Control**  21.65%  43.38%
Diabetes Care-Eye Exam  70.31%  51.32%
Diabetes Care-Kidney Function Screening  84.31%  78.00%
Appropriate Medication for People with Asthma  94.30%  92.71%
Follow-up After Hospitalization with Mental Illness-7 day  62.79%  55.96%
Follow-up After Hospitalization with Mental Illness-30 day  91.47%  74.68%
Postpartum Care  86.37%  72.76%
Controlling High Blood Pressure  70.07%  61.82%
